Source File: RocksDBNativeMetricMonitorTest.java    From Flink-CEPplus with Apache License 2.0 4 votes vote down vote up
@Test
public void testMetricMonitorLifecycle() throws Throwable {
	//We use a local variable here to manually control the life-cycle.
	// This allows us to verify that metrics do not try to access
	// RocksDB after the monitor was closed.
	RocksDBResource localRocksDBResource = new RocksDBResource();
	localRocksDBResource.before();

	SimpleMetricRegistry registry = new SimpleMetricRegistry();
	GenericMetricGroup group = new GenericMetricGroup(
		registry,
		UnregisteredMetricGroups.createUnregisteredTaskMetricGroup(),
		OPERATOR_NAME
	);

	RocksDBNativeMetricOptions options = new RocksDBNativeMetricOptions();
	// always returns a non-zero
	// value since empty memtables
	// have overhead.
	options.enableSizeAllMemTables();

	RocksDBNativeMetricMonitor monitor = new RocksDBNativeMetricMonitor(
		options,
		group,
		localRocksDBResource.getRocksDB()
	);

	ColumnFamilyHandle handle = localRocksDBResource.createNewColumnFamily(COLUMN_FAMILY_NAME);
	monitor.registerColumnFamily(COLUMN_FAMILY_NAME, handle);

	Assert.assertEquals("Failed to register metrics for column family", 1, registry.metrics.size());

	RocksDBNativeMetricMonitor.RocksDBNativeMetricView view = registry.metrics.get(0);

	view.update();

	Assert.assertNotEquals("Failed to pull metric from RocksDB", BigInteger.ZERO, view.getValue());

	view.setValue(0L);

	//After the monitor is closed no metric should be accessing RocksDB anymore.
	//If they do, then this test will likely fail with a segmentation fault.
	monitor.close();

	localRocksDBResource.after();

	view.update();

	Assert.assertEquals("Failed to release RocksDB reference", BigInteger.ZERO, view.getValue());
}

Source File: StreamTaskTerminationTest.java    From flink with Apache License 2.0 4 votes vote down vote up
/**
 * FLINK-6833
 *
 * <p>Tests that a finished stream task cannot be failed by an asynchronous checkpointing operation after
 * the stream task has stopped running.
 */
@Test
public void testConcurrentAsyncCheckpointCannotFailFinishedStreamTask() throws Exception {
	final Configuration taskConfiguration = new Configuration();
	final StreamConfig streamConfig = new StreamConfig(taskConfiguration);
	final NoOpStreamOperator<Long> noOpStreamOperator = new NoOpStreamOperator<>();

	final StateBackend blockingStateBackend = new BlockingStateBackend();

	streamConfig.setStreamOperator(noOpStreamOperator);
	streamConfig.setOperatorID(new OperatorID());
	streamConfig.setStateBackend(blockingStateBackend);

	final long checkpointId = 0L;
	final long checkpointTimestamp = 0L;

	final JobInformation jobInformation = new JobInformation(
		new JobID(),
		"Test Job",
		new SerializedValue<>(new ExecutionConfig()),
		new Configuration(),
		Collections.emptyList(),
		Collections.emptyList());

	final TaskInformation taskInformation = new TaskInformation(
		new JobVertexID(),
		"Test Task",
		1,
		1,
		BlockingStreamTask.class.getName(),
		taskConfiguration);

	final TaskManagerRuntimeInfo taskManagerRuntimeInfo = new TestingTaskManagerRuntimeInfo();

	final ShuffleEnvironment<?, ?> shuffleEnvironment = new NettyShuffleEnvironmentBuilder().build();

	final Task task = new Task(
		jobInformation,
		taskInformation,
		new ExecutionAttemptID(),
		new AllocationID(),
		0,
		0,
		Collections.<ResultPartitionDeploymentDescriptor>emptyList(),
		Collections.<InputGateDeploymentDescriptor>emptyList(),
		0,
		MemoryManagerBuilder.newBuilder().setMemorySize(32L * 1024L).build(),
		new IOManagerAsync(),
		shuffleEnvironment,
		new KvStateService(new KvStateRegistry(), null, null),
		mock(BroadcastVariableManager.class),
		new TaskEventDispatcher(),
		ExternalResourceInfoProvider.NO_EXTERNAL_RESOURCES,
		new TestTaskStateManager(),
		mock(TaskManagerActions.class),
		mock(InputSplitProvider.class),
		mock(CheckpointResponder.class),
		new NoOpTaskOperatorEventGateway(),
		new TestGlobalAggregateManager(),
		TestingClassLoaderLease.newBuilder().build(),
		mock(FileCache.class),
		taskManagerRuntimeInfo,
		UnregisteredMetricGroups.createUnregisteredTaskMetricGroup(),
		new NoOpResultPartitionConsumableNotifier(),
		mock(PartitionProducerStateChecker.class),
		Executors.directExecutor());

	CompletableFuture<Void> taskRun = CompletableFuture.runAsync(
		() -> task.run(),
		TestingUtils.defaultExecutor());

	// wait until the stream task started running
	RUN_LATCH.await();

	// trigger a checkpoint
	task.triggerCheckpointBarrier(checkpointId, checkpointTimestamp, CheckpointOptions.forCheckpointWithDefaultLocation(), false);

	// wait until the task has completed execution
	taskRun.get();

	// check that no failure occurred
	if (task.getFailureCause() != null) {
		throw new Exception("Task failed", task.getFailureCause());
	}

	// check that we have entered the finished state
	assertEquals(ExecutionState.FINISHED, task.getExecutionState());
}
